Know before you go
- Guests can arrange to bring pets by contacting the property directly, using the contact information on the booking confirmation.
Check-in: after 2 PM.
Check-out: before noon.
A tax is imposed by the city and will be collected at the property (check Mandatory Fees and Taxes section for fee details). This tax does not apply to residents of Venice City and children under 10 years of age. Further exemptions may apply, subject to submission of proper documents to the property, to patients, their companions and people staying in the city for specific purposes/duties. 30% reduction applies for 2012: from 1 to 31 December; for 2013: from 1 to 31 January and from 1 to 31 December.

How to reach Boscolo Bellini Hotel
By carVia the highway A4 follow signs to Venezia. After the Ponte della Libertà 4km bridge, proceed to the Piazzale Roma car park and bus terminal. Leave your car there and proceed on foot. You will find the hotel after crossing the Calatrava Bridge.
By train
The hotel is 200 metres from the Santa Lucia railway station.
By airplane
From Venice Marco Polo Airport take a water taxi until Piazzale Roma (approx. 20 minutes travel time), and then proceed on foot as above described.
